> One more thing.... how do you prevent it from setting DNS values ?

Unless you ask ppp to transact for the DNS it doesnt. ( i forget the exact
ppp -option )


> I hate proggies editing file in the etc directory! and this thing edits
> the pap-secrets file and resolv.conf files all the time.

pap secrets editing becomes necessary, if your ISP uses pap, because ppp
takes the passwds from there. As far as resolv.conf goes, it does not
touch mine. May be you run ppp with the options to get the dns server
through the transaction. Disable that, and you should be fine.
